What Are Some Challenges To Treating Exotic Animals?

The main challenges involved with treating exotic animals were difficulties in diagnosis, lack of available treatment options, lack of owner knowledge , unwillingness of the owner to spend money treating his animal and the difficulties in handling and examining the animals.

What are some of the problems with exotic animals?

Exotic animals pose serious health risks to humans . Many exotic animals are carriers of zoonotic diseases, such as Herpes B, Monkey Pox, and Salmonellosis, all of which are communicable to humans. A large percentage of macaque monkeys carry the Herpes B virus.

Why animals should not be kept as pets?

Keeping wild animals as pets can be dangerous . Many can bite, scratch, and attack an owner, children, or guests. Animal owners can be legally responsible for any damage, injuries or illnesses caused by animals they maintain.

Why is it illegal to own exotic pets?

Many exotic pets are illegal because someone thinks they will harm the environment either by escaping and forming invasive populations or introducing diseases .
